🏀 VJBL 2026 Competition Restructure Announced! 🏀

Basketball Victoria has confirmed a major restructure to the Victorian Junior Basketball League beginning in 2026, with the launch of the Regional League (RL).

This new format replaces the RDL trial and creates a clearer three-tier pathway for junior players:
1️⃣ Victorian Championship (VC) – Elite state-level competition
2️⃣ Victorian Junior League (VJL) – Graded divisions
3️⃣ Regional League (RL) – Geographical pools designed to reduce travel

✨ What changes for each age group?
🔹 Under 12 – VC, VJL 1–5, RL (geographic pools)
🔹 Under 14 – VC, VJL 1–8, RL (geographic pools)
🔹 Under 16 – VC, VJL 1–5+, RL (geographic pools)
🔹 Under 18 – VC, VJL 1–5+, RL (geographic pools)

Wyndham Basketball Association Welcomes New Coaching Directors

Wyndham Basketball Association (WBA) is proud to announce the appointment of two outstanding individuals to key leadership roles within our coaching team. Please join us in welcoming Tom Latus as our new Director of Coaching – Domestic, and Matt Stephens as our new Director of Coaching – Representative.

These appointments mark a significant step forward in WBA’s commitment to elevating basketball development at both grassroots and representative levels.

Tom Latus brings with him extensive knowledge and experience in community and domestic basketball. A passionate advocate for participation and inclusion, Tom will work closely with James Welsh (WBA Participation Coordinator) and Kylie Bozanic (WBA Inclusion Officer) to deliver inclusive and engaging programs such as Aussie Hoops, the Domestic Development Academy, Wyndham School Clinics, and Inclusion Programs.

Tom will also play a key role in supporting WBA’s Club Coaching Coordinators, helping to build consistency and confidence across coaching standards. His ability to engage with both coaches and players makes him an exciting addition to the domestic basketball space at WBA.

Matt Stephens is no stranger to the Wyndham basketball community. With over 15 years of coaching experience in the VJBL, 10 years in the Big V, and his current role as a Basketball Victoria High Performance Coach, Matt brings a wealth of expertise and a deep connection to the local basketball scene.

As Director of Coaching – Representative, Matt will lead the development of a progressive and high-impact curriculum for all representative levels, from Under 12s through to Under 20s. He will oversee programs including Rising Stars, Representative Holiday Camps, and our elite High-Performance pathways, while also mentoring our junior representative coaches.

Together, Tom and Matt will provide strong leadership, education, and mentoring to players and coaches alike, supporting them in their development and helping them thrive within their chosen basketball pathways at Wyndham Basketball.

We are excited for the future and confident that their combined experience and vision will help take WBA to the next level.

Wyndham Basketball Association (WBA) is taking a proactive step to ensure a safer, more welcoming environment across its competitions and events with the launch of a 12-month Body Worn Camera (BWC) trial. Beginning on June 2, the initiative will see authorised Competition Supervisors and WBA Executive Team Members wearing BWC during senior domestic competitions on Monday and Wednesday evenings at Eagle Stadium.

The trial, developed in consultation with key stakeholders including Western Leisure Services, Wyndham City Council, and Basketball Victoria, aims to reduce antisocial behaviour and support safer community sport. The BWCs will only be activated when necessary, in public spaces, and patrons will be notified when recording begins.

Strict protocols have been put in place to protect the privacy of players, staff, and spectators, ensuring all footage is managed in line with legal requirements. Clear signage, staff training, and online communications will keep the community informed throughout the trial.

The Wyndham Disability Connection Expo is back and ready to help those living with a disability feel more connected with the wider community.People with disabilities, their families, carers and support persons will have the opportunity to connect with support services in the area, as well as meet other people living with disability.

Guests will be able to acquaint themselves with resources that may help them gain employment skills, refer them to the most suitable health clinicians and discover social opportunities. Kylie Bozanic runs the Wyndham All Abilities Basketball club, and has been involved in the planning of the expo for the past 12 months.

“The day is more so to connect people with the providers, but then also people with disabilities can find activities and respite options as well,” she said.

“Without knowing where to actually find these services, they can be very hard to locate.”

Ms. Bozanic said programs such as all abilities basketball, which will feature at the expo, can make a world of difference in the life of someone with disabilities.

“It’s a sense of belonging, and it becomes part of their routine which means they can become better connected with the community,” she said.

“They have somewhere they belong and can really make friends out it.”

This event is open to everyone, those with lived experience of disability, NDIS participants, and those not NDIS supported. The expo will run at the Encore Event’s Centre in Hoppers Crossing between 10am-3pm on Thursday, May 29.
